ORLANDO, Fla. (UCFAthletics.com) - Thursday nights will see UCF football fans congregating in a new place to celebrate their team as the George O'Leary Call-In Show and will be held at the new MOAT Sports Grille in conjunction with ISP Sports.
The brand-new UCF-themed MOAT Sports Grille is located right across the street from campus at 4250 Alafaya Trail (corner of McCulloch Road) in the University Palms Shopping Center in Oviedo.
"We at the MOAT Sports Grille are very excited to be the new home for the George O'Leary call in show," said MOAT owner Mike Couillard. "We are looking forward to using our venue to further support all of the UCF athletic programs."
The call-in show will continue to be hosted by the Voice of the Knights, Marc Daniels, and will air on Thursday nights for Saturday game weeks from 7-8 p.m. on 740 The Game, the flagship station of the UCF ISP Sports Network. The live radio show always features a review of the previous week's contest and a look ahead to that upcoming week's opponent along with other talk about the UCF football team. There is also time for calls and live questions from UCF fans in attendance. Fans with questions can call (407) 916-8255 locally or toll free at (800) 729-8255.
There is no shortage of excitement around the Knights as they embark on their second week of preseason c amp. UCF returns 17 starters and is picked by several magazines to with the East Division of Conference USA, building off of an 8-5 campaign in 2009 which landed the team in the St. Petersburg Bowl.
